IMPORTANCE
After aneurysmal subarachnoid hemorrhage, the use of lumbar drains has been suggested to decrease the incidence of delayed cerebral ischemia and improve long-term outcome.
OBJECTIVE
To determine the effectiveness of early lumbar cerebrospinal fluid drainage added to standard of care in patients after aneurysmal subarachnoid hemorrhage.
DESIGN, SETTING, AND PARTICIPANTS
The EARLYDRAIN trial was a pragmatic, multicenter, parallel-group, open-label randomized clinical trial with blinded end point evaluation conducted at 19 centers in Germany, Switzerland, and Canada. The first patient entered January 31, 2011, and the last on January 24, 2016, after 307 randomizations. Follow-up was completed July 2016. Query and retrieval of data on missing items in the case report forms was completed in September 2020. A total of 20 randomizations were invalid, the main reason being lack of informed consent. No participants meeting all inclusion and exclusion criteria were excluded from the intention-to-treat analysis. Exclusion of patients was only performed in per-protocol sensitivity analysis. A total of 287 adult patients with acute aneurysmal subarachnoid hemorrhage of all clinical grades were analyzable. Aneurysm treatment with clipping or coiling was performed within 48 hours.
INTERVENTION
A total of 144 patients were randomized to receive an additional lumbar drain after aneurysm treatment and 143 patients to standard of care only. Early lumbar drainage with 5 mL per hour was started within 72 hours of the subarachnoid hemorrhage.
MAIN OUTCOMES AND MEASURES
Primary outcome was the rate of unfavorable outcome, defined as modified Rankin Scale score of 3 to 6 (range, 0 to 6), obtained by masked assessors 6 months after hemorrhage.
RESULTS
Of 287 included patients, 197 (68.6%) were female, and the median (IQR) age was 55 (48-63) years. Lumbar drainage started at a median (IQR) of day 2 (1-2) after aneurysmal subarachnoid hemorrhage. At 6 months, 47 patients (32.6%) in the lumbar drain group and 64 patients (44.8%) in the standard of care group had an unfavorable neurological outcome (risk ratio, 0.73; 95% CI, 0.52 to 0.98; absolute risk difference, -0.12; 95% CI, -0.23 to -0.01; P = .04). Patients treated with a lumbar drain had fewer secondary infarctions at discharge (41 patients [28.5%] vs 57 patients [39.9%]; risk ratio, 0.71; 95% CI, 0.49 to 0.99; absolute risk difference, -0.11; 95% CI, -0.22 to 0; P = .04).
CONCLUSION AND RELEVANCE
In this trial, prophylactic lumbar drainage after aneurysmal subarachnoid hemorrhage lessened the burden of secondary infarction and decreased the rate of unfavorable outcome at 6 months. These findings support the use of lumbar drains after aneurysmal subarachnoid hemorrhage.

Nasogastric feeding tube insertion is a common but invasive procedure most often blindly placed by nurses in acute and chronic care settings. Although usually not harmful, serious and fatal complications with misplacement still occur and variation in practice still exists. These tubes can be used for drainage or administration of fluids, drugs and/or enteral feeding. During blind insertion, it is important to achieve correct tip position of the tube ideally reaching the body of the stomach. If the insertion length is too short, the tip and/or distal side-openings at the end of the tube can be located in the esophagus increasing the risk of aspiration (pneumonia). Conversely, when the insertion length is too long, the tube might kink in the stomach, curl upwards into the esophagus or enter the duodenum. Studies have demonstrated that the most frequently used technique to determine insertion length (the nose-earlobe-xiphoid method) is too short a distance; new safer methods should be used and further more robust evidence is needed. After blind placement, verifying correct gastric tip positioning is of major importance to avoid serious and sometimes lethal complications.

Skull development coincides with the onset of cerebrospinal fluid (CSF) circulation, brain-CSF perfusion, and meningeal lymphangiogenesis, processes essential for brain waste clearance. How these processes are affected by craniofacial disorders such as craniosynostosis are poorly understood. We report that raised intracranial pressure and diminished CSF flow in craniosynostosis mouse models associate with pathological changes to meningeal lymphatic vessels that affect their sprouting, expansion, and long-term maintenance. We also show that craniosynostosis affects CSF circulatory pathways and perfusion into the brain. Further, craniosynostosis exacerbates amyloid pathology and plaque buildup in Twist1+/-:5xFAD transgenic Alzheimer's disease models. Treating craniosynostosis mice with Yoda1, a small molecule agonist for Piezo1, reduces intracranial pressure and improves CSF flow, in addition to restoring meningeal lymphangiogenesis, drainage to the deep cervical lymph nodes, and brain-CSF perfusion. Leveraging these findings, we show that Yoda1 treatments in aged mice with reduced CSF flow and turnover improve lymphatic networks, drainage, and brain-CSF perfusion. Our results suggest that CSF provides mechanical force to facilitate meningeal lymphatic growth and maintenance. Additionally, applying Yoda1 agonist in conditions with raised intracranial pressure and/or diminished CSF flow, as seen in craniosynostosis or with ageing, is a possible therapeutic option to help restore meningeal lymphatic networks and brain-CSF perfusion.

Ludwig's angina is a severe diffuse cellulitis that presents an acute onset and spreads rapidly and bilaterally. It can affect the submandibular, sublingual or submental spaces resulting in a state of emergency. Early diagnosis and urgent management could be a life-saving procedure. We report a case of wide spread sialadenitis infection extending to the neck with trismus and elevation of the floor of the mouth that caused an obstruction of the airway and resulted in an inspiratory dyspnea and a stridor. The patient was directed to maintain the airway by elective tracheostomy. An appropriate use of parenteral antibiotics, airway protection techniques, and potential surgical drainage of the infection remain the standard protocol of treatment in advanced cases of Ludwig's angina. The aim of this case report is to emphasize on the importance of early diagnosis and appropriate management of Ludwig's angina.

This year, 2023, marks the fiftieth anniversary of the introduction of therapeutic endoscopic retrograde cholangiopancreatography (ERCP), which completely changed the management of biliary and pancreatic diseases. As in other invasive procedures, two intrinsically related concepts soon appeared: drainage success and complications. It was observed that ERCP is the most dangerous procedure regularly performed by gastrointestinal endoscopists, with a morbidity and mortality of 5-10 % and 0.1-1 %, respectively. ERCP is by far one of the best examples of a complex endoscopic technique.

The article by Ker explores the treatment of peripancreatic fluid collection (PFC). The use of percutaneous drainage, endoscopy, and surgery for managing PFC are discussed. Percutaneous drainage is noted for its low risk profile, while endoscopic cystogastrostomy is more effective due to the wider orifice of the metallic stent. Surgical cystogastrostomy is a definitive treatment with a reduced need for reintervention, especially for cases with extensive collections and significant necrosis. The choice of treatment modality should be tailored to individual patient characteristics and disease factors, considering the expertise available.

OBJECTIVES
To compare the efficacy of negative pressure wound therapy (NPWT) and alginate dressings on wound bed preparation prior to split thickness skin graft (STSG) surgery for patients with chronic diabetic foot ulcers (DFUs).
METHODS
Between September 2022 and March 2023, we completed a randomized controlled trial in Nanjing First Hospital and PLA 454 Hospital. Patients were divided into 2 groups: i) the NPWT group (with vacuum-assisted closure, n=50); ii) the control group (with alginates dressings, n=50). Once DFU wound was filled with healthy granulation tissues, STSG surgery was performed. The time to STSG surgery was regarded as the primary outcome. The survival rates of skin graft, the wound blood perfusion, the wound neutrophil extracellular traps (NETs) formation, and polarization of M1 and M2 macrophages in DFU wounds were regarded ad secondary outcomes.
RESULTS
Patients in the NPWT group had less time to STSG surgery than the control group. The patients in the NPWT group had prominently increased survival rates of skin graft, increased wound blood perfusion, and decreased NET formation in comparison with the control group. The macrophages in DFU wounds switched from M1 to M2 phenotype in the NPWT group.
CONCLUSION
Negative pressure wound therapy is superior to conventional moist dressings in wound bed preparation prior to STSG surgery for patients with chronic DFUs.

BACKGROUND
Tendon-exposed wounds are complex injuries with challenging reconstructions and no unified treatment mode. Furthermore, insufficient tissue volume and blood circulation disorders affect healing, which increases pain for the patient and affects their families and caretakers.
REVIEW
As modern medicine advances, considerable progress has been made in understanding and treating tendon-exposed wounds, and current research encompasses both macro-and micro-studies. Additionally, new treatment methods have emerged alongside the classic surgical methods, such as new dressing therapies, vacuum sealing drainage combination therapy, platelet-rich plasma therapy, and live-cell bioengineering.
CONCLUSIONS
This review summarizes the latest treatment methods for tendon-exposed wounds to provide ideas and improve their treatment.

Drainage from chronic wounds can significantly negatively impact a patient's quality of life. Change in severity of wound drainage is an important measure of treatment efficacy for wounds. This study reviews existing tools used to assess wound drainage. Qualitative drainage tools are overall less burdensome, and however, differences in user interpretation may reduce inter-rater reliability. Quantitative drainage tools enable more reliable comparisons of drainage severity and treatment response between patients but sometimes require equipment to administer, increasing responder burden. Gaps in the current wound drainage measurement landscape are highlighted. Many of the existing scales have not been validated in robust studies. There is also a lack of validated global drainage measurement tools for patients with chronic inflammatory skin disorders with drainage, such as hidradenitis suppurativa or pyoderma gangrenosum. Development of a succinct drainage measurement tool for inflammatory skin diseases where drainage is a prominent symptom will improve monitoring of meaningful treatment response.

Endoscopic Ultrasound-Guided Biliary Drainage of First Intent With a Lumen-Apposing Metal Stent vs Endoscopic Retrograde Cholangiopancreatography in Malignant Distal Biliary Obstruction: A Multicenter Randomized Controlled Study (ELEMENT Trial).
BACKGROUND & AIMS
Endoscopic ultrasound-guided choledochoduodenostomy with a lumen-apposing metal stent (EUS-CDS) is a promising modality for management of malignant distal biliary obstruction (MDBO) with potential for better stent patency. We compared its outcomes with endoscopic retrograde cholangiopancreatography with metal stenting (ERCP-M).
METHODS
In this multicenter randomized controlled trial, we recruited patients with MDBO secondary to borderline resectable, locally advanced, or unresectable peri-ampullary cancers across 10 Canadian institutions and 1 French institution. This was a superiority trial with a noninferiority assessment of technical success. Patients were randomized to EUS-CDS or ERCP-M. The primary end point was the rate of stent dysfunction at 1 year, considering competing risks of death, clinical failure, and surgical resection. Analyses were performed according to intention-to-treat principles.
RESULTS
From February 2019 to February 2022, 144 patients were recruited; 73 were randomized to EUS-CDS and 71 were randomized to ERCP-M. The mean (SD) procedure time was 14.0 (11.4) minutes for EUS-CDS and 23.1 (15.6) minutes for ERCP-M (P < .01); 40% of the former was performed without fluoroscopy. Technical success was achieved in 90.4% (95% CI, 81.5% to 95.3%) of EUS-CDS and 83.1% (95% CI, 72.7% to 90.1%) of ERCP-M with a risk difference of 7.3% (95% CI, -4.0% to 18.8%) indicating noninferiority. Stent dysfunction occurred in 9.6% vs 9.9% of EUS-CDS and ERCP-M cases, respectively (P = .96). No differences in adverse events, pancreaticoduodenectomy and oncologic outcomes, or quality of life were noted.
CONCLUSIONS
Although not superior in stent function, EUS-CDS is an efficient and safe alternative to ERCP-M in patients with MDBO. These findings provide evidence for greater adoption of EUS-CDS in clinical practice as a complementary and exchangeable first-line modality to ERCP in patients with MDBO.
